FLOODING in parts of Laidley reached higher peaks on Monday than in the 2011 floods, according to Lockyer Valley Regional Council mayor Steve Jones.
RESIDENTS in low-lying areas of Ipswich needed little prompting to start the enormous task of packing up their belongings on Monday.
LATEST: The Bremer River peaked at 13.9 metres at about 9.30pm in Ipswich on Monday, almost five metres below the 19.4 metre peak in 2011.
